August 28, 2025- The Faculty of Procurement and Supply Chain Management recently had the privilege of hosting Mr. Christian Noske and Mr. Thomas Zink from the Kuehne Foundation LEARN Logistics program for an engaging two-day business simulation seminar focused on value chain management.

During the seminar, students gained hands-on experience by managing the full supply chain of a fresh juice product, applying theoretical knowledge to real-world challenges like inventory control, logistics, and demand forecasting. Interactive sessions led by Mr. Noske and Mr. Zink focused on value chain optimization and the importance of collaboration across key supply chain functions. The initiative highlights the Faculty’s dedication to providing students with practical skills and industry knowledge for global competitiveness.
